Etymology of the name: roots and original meaning

Edita is a name of Spanish origin that is derived from the name Edith. The name Edith itself has Old English roots and is composed of the elements “ead,” meaning wealth or fortune, and “gyð,” meaning war or strife. Therefore, the name Edita carries the original meaning of “prosperous in battle” or “rich in war.” This strong and empowering connotation reflects the historical significance and resilience associated with the name.
